Understanding Rutherford's Terroir


Rutherford's terroir is defined by its varied dirts, environment, and topography. The alluvial soil composition, enhanced with gravel, clay, and loam, cultivates superb water drainage and nutrient schedule for grapevines.


The area's Mediterranean climate, with cozy days and cool nights, promotes well balanced acidity and optimum ripening. These climatic conditions develop a perfect setting for expanding Cabernet Sauvignon, Red Wine, and various other varietals.


This interplay of aspects leads to red wines known for their deep tastes, intricacy, and maturing possible. Rutherford's terroir not only adds to the character of its red wines yet also commemorates the rich agricultural heritage of the area.

Best Times to See Rutherford Wineries


The optimal times to visit Rutherford wineries are during the spring and loss. Springtime showcases blooming vines and moderate weather, perfect for outdoor samplings. Loss offers the vivid grape harvest, creating a joyful environment. Weekends have a tendency to be busier, so weekdays can give a more intimate experience.


Seeing during top harvest period from late September to October enables guests to witness grape selecting and processing.


Secret events, such as a glass of wine launches and festivals, occur frequently. It's a good idea to check regional winery calendars for special activities. Bookings are often advised. Verifying accessibility in advance can enhance the experience.

The Art of Red Wine Sampling


A glass of wine tasting includes a methodical technique to appreciate the intricacies of wine. The procedure generally consists of four main steps: look, swirl, scent, and preference.



  1. Look: Observe the white wine's shade and clarity. A much deeper shade can show age or focus.


  2. Swirl: Swirling the red wine freshens it and launches aromas. This step is essential for preparing the palate.


  3. Odor: Inhale the scents. Red wine can exhibit different fragrances ranging from fruits to spices, which add to its account.


  4. Taste: Take a small sip, permitting the red wine to layer the taste. Examine flavors, body, and coating.



By focusing on these elements, one can get a deeper appreciation for the a glass of wine's personality.


Tasting Area Rules


Proper decorum in a sampling area enhances the experience for everyone included. Visitors ought to maintain a couple of crucial guidelines in mind.



  • Show up on schedule: Preparation shows respect for the host and other visitors.


  • Ask Questions: Involving with staff shows passion. Inquire about the vineyard's history or the wine making procedure.


  • Share Area: Bear in mind individual area, specifically in smaller sized sampling areas. Standing as well close can make others uneasy.


  • Spit or Swallow: It's common to spit out wine after sampling to stay clear of overconsumption. Choose what jobs best for private preferences.



Adhering to these guidelines guarantees a positive and respectful sampling environment.

Famous Rutherford Wineries


Rutherford is home to a number of celebrated wineries that form its credibility. Rutherford Winery is noteworthy for its abundant history and remarkable Cabernet Sauvignon. Visitors often applaud its lovely estate and well-informed staff.


Caymus Vineyards sticks out for its acclaimed Cabernet blends, with samplings often booked well in advance. The intimate setting permits visitors to find out about the winemaking procedure directly from experts.


An additional top selection is St. Supéry Estate Vineyards & Winery, recognized for its commitment to natural farming and high-grade wines. Their sampling area supplies a modern yet inviting ambience, making it an excellent area for sampling and relaxation.
